  18. It's about getting funding from the SFA for coaching and playing fixtures against the other best academies. If this elite 8 thing happens and we're not in it we'll probably have to cut back on coaches and will be a second class team in terms of fixtures. It will make it harder for us to recruit and keep talented young players.
  19. I didn't know anything about this until McGhee brought it up the other week. Cutting the size of the pro youth system is a good idea but giving all the funding to eight elite clubs is crazy. There is talk of an elite Highland academy despite the fact that the total population of the Highlands is less around a third of that of Lanarkshire and there are far fewer kids. I suspect that the Old Firm want a clear run at the entire west of Scotland which is why we are being marginalised.
